Customers need more than something that looks modern.
A good website should help the customer understand the offer, trust the business and complete the next step with as little unnecessary effort as possible.
Clarity
Make the offer understandable without making customers decode the business.
Trust
Provide useful evidence and remove avoidable uncertainty.
Mobile
Treat the phone experience as its own journey rather than a smaller desktop site.
Action
Make enquiry, booking, purchasing or contacting obvious and easy to complete.
Sometimes the better answer is to keep the website you already have.
If the foundation is sound, a smaller set of high-impact changes may produce more value than rebuilding everything.
